Job Description

As an Infotainment Feature Test Lead at GM, you will be responsible for the end-to-end QA for a variety of Infotainment features. You will ensure the quality of your assigned features by tracking development plans, designing test cases, collaborating with automation engineers, and requesting calibration updates. This exciting infotainment test position is a central hub for the testing and integration of all GM's infotainment software. You will have the opportunity to collaborate with different business units all around GM and is terrific for technical and leadership growth!

Responsibilities:

  • Responsible for end-to-end quality assurance for a variety of assigned Infotainment features up to and including performance testing.
  • Track feature development in Jira and align timing of required quality assurance activities on a VESCOM basis.
  • Develop test plans by leveraging DevQA test cases and creating new test cases.
  • Manage calibration CRs to ensure that effective testing can be executed.
  • Collaborate with test automation engineers to develop test methods that enable test script development.
  • Collaborate with test script development engineers to automate test plans.
  • Monitor weekly test execution and support issue triage with test execution and software development engineers.
  • Support new feature integration testing.
  • Provide regular status updates and PVCL signoff for assigned features.

Additional Job Description

Minimum Qualifications

  • Bachelor of Science in Computer Science,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ering or related
  • Minimum of 5 years’ experience in Automotive SW Test or Development, including extensive experience with test automation
  • Understanding of Vehicle Electrical Architecture and Subsystem/Features in the Infotainment domain
  • Understanding of Infotainment Operating Systems such as Android, Linux and QNX
  • Experience with LAN/CAN vehicle communication system and CAN based monitoring tools

Preferred Qualifications

  • Experience with Robot Framework
  • Strong Project Management and Organizational skills
  • Ability to lead complex problems and propose solutions
  • High level of oral and written communication skills, interpersonal skills to work independently and effectively with others.
